African Union issues call for scientific awards

The African Union (AU) is calling for applications for its scientific awards. The awards will be offered in two sectors: life and earth sciences, and basic science, technology and innovation.

The awards have three categories:

  • the AU-TWAS young scientist award, which is reserved for scientists who are below the age of 40;
  • the AU regional award for women scientists;
  • the African Union continental scientific award.
Prize money worth US$5,000, US$20,000 and US$100,000, will be given to each of the recipients of the awards, respectively. Applicants whose documents are incomplete, are employees of regional economic communities, have received an AU award in the past five years or are nationals of member states, which are under AU sanctions, are disqualified.

The closing dates for the applications are 30 June 2010 for the AU-TWAS young scientist award, which must be submitted to the national academies of sciences or research councils.

The AU regional award for women scientists must be handed in at the regional economic communities by no later than 15 July 2010.

The deadline for the African Union continental scientific award is 9 September 2010. Application documents for this award must be posted to human resources, science and technology department, African Union Commission, PO Box 3243, Addis Ababa, Ethiopia.

Application forms for the three categories can be accessed via email from scientific-awards@africa-union.org.
